Understanding Stainless Steel Grades: 304 vs 316L for Food Contact Surfaces

When sourcing or manufacturing commercial furniture for food service environments—restaurant booths, bar counters, salon equipment, or kitchen worktables—stainless steel grade selection is one of the most critical decisions affecting product quality, compliance, and cost. This section provides objective, industry-standard information to help Southeast Asian exporters understand the real differences between 304 and 316L stainless steel, without pushing one configuration as universally superior.

Chemical Composition Comparison [1][2]

304 Stainless Steel: 18-20% Chromium, 8-10.5% Nickel, 0% Molybdenum, max 0.08% Carbon

316L Stainless Steel: 16-18.5% Chromium, 10-14% Nickel, 2-3% Molybdenum, max 0.03% Carbon (L = Low carbon)

The key difference lies in molybdenum content. 316L contains 2-3% molybdenum, which significantly enhances resistance to chloride-induced corrosion—making it suitable for marine environments, chemical processing, or applications involving salt, acids, or harsh cleaning agents. For typical restaurant, café, or salon furniture where exposure is limited to water, mild detergents, and normal food acids, 304 provides adequate corrosion resistance at a substantially lower cost [1].

Industry data from multiple sources indicates 316L commands a 20-35% price premium over 304 stainless steel [2][3]. This premium is justified only when the operating environment presents genuine chloride exposure risks: coastal locations, seafood processing, high-salinity cleaning protocols, or chemical handling. For standard commercial furniture applications, specifying 316L may represent unnecessary cost that reduces competitiveness without adding proportional value.

Both 304 and 316L meet FDA 21 CFR 175.300 requirements for food contact surfaces, which mandates minimum 16% chromium content for stainless steel. Both grades also comply with EU Regulation 1935/2004 and can achieve NSF certification when manufactured to appropriate standards [2][3]. The choice between them should be driven by environmental factors and budget constraints, not by assumptions that higher grade always equals better quality.

Surface Finish Requirements: Ra Values and Sanitary Standards

Surface finish is often more critical than grade selection for food safety compliance. A poorly finished 316L surface can harbor more bacteria than a properly polished 304 surface. Industry standards define surface roughness using Ra (Roughness Average) values measured in micrometers (μm) or microinches (μin) [3].

Surface Finish Ra Requirements by Application Type [3]

Application CategoryMaximum Ra ValueTypical FinishCleaning Frequency
General Food Contact (restaurants, cafés)Ra ≤0.8μm (32 μin)2B or #4 BrushedDaily sanitization
Dairy & High-Risk Food ProcessingRa ≤0.4μm (16 μin)#4 Polish or BetterMultiple times daily
Pharmaceutical & BiotechRa ≤0.25μm (10 μin)ElectropolishedSterilization required
Non-Food Commercial FurnitureRa ≤1.6μm (63 μin)2B Mill FinishStandard cleaning
Source: Industry standards from DAPU Metal technical documentation [3]. Lower Ra values indicate smoother surfaces that resist bacterial adhesion and are easier to clean.

The relationship between surface finish and bacterial contamination is quantifiable. Research cited in welding industry discussions indicates that sandblasted surfaces can harbor up to 13x more bacteria than properly polished surfaces [5]. This has direct implications for welding and fabrication processes: welds must be ground smooth and passivated to restore corrosion resistance, and back purging (using inert gas on the backside of welds) prevents oxidation that creates contamination traps.

For Southeast Asian exporters targeting North American and European markets, understanding these finish requirements is essential. Many buyers specify 'food grade' without understanding Ra values—sellers who can educate buyers on finish specifications demonstrate expertise and reduce post-purchase disputes. Electropolishing, while adding cost, provides superior corrosion resistance and cleanability for high-end applications [3].

These user voices reveal three recurring themes that Southeast Asian exporters must address:

1. Material Authenticity: Buyers increasingly encounter products marketed as 'stainless steel' where only visible surfaces are genuine stainless, while structural components use cheaper materials. This erodes trust and generates negative reviews. Transparency in product specifications is essential.

2. Surface Quality & Rust: Even genuine stainless steel can develop rust spots if surface finish is inadequate, welding is poorly executed, or protective passivation is skipped. Buyers expect rust-free performance in normal indoor environments.

3. Certification Credibility: NSF certification is frequently mentioned as a purchase requirement for commercial kitchens. Sellers must ensure certifications are genuine and verifiable, not just claimed in listings [4][5][6].

Configuration Comparison: Neutral Analysis of Different Stainless Steel Options

This section provides an objective comparison of common stainless steel configurations for commercial furniture. There is no single 'best' configuration—the optimal choice depends on target market, price positioning, and application environment. We present facts without recommending one option over others.

Stainless Steel Configuration Comparison for Commercial Furniture [1][2][3][4]

ConfigurationCost LevelBest ForLimitationsBuyer Expectations
304 Stainless, 2B FinishLow-MediumStandard restaurant furniture, indoor café equipment, salon furnitureNot suitable for coastal/high-salt environments, limited acid resistanceMost common, cost-effective, meets basic NSF requirements
304 Stainless, #4 BrushedMediumHigh-visibility food prep areas, premium restaurant furnitureHigher cost than 2B, requires more maintenance to maintain appearanceExpected for customer-facing surfaces, easier to clean than 2B
316L Stainless, 2B FinishHighCoastal locations, seafood restaurants, chemical exposure environments20-35% cost premium over 304, over-specified for most indoor applicationsBuyers in harsh environments expect this, requires justification for premium
316L Stainless, ElectropolishedVery HighPharmaceutical, biotech, high-end food processing equipmentSignificant cost premium, longer lead times, specialized manufacturers onlyNiche market, buyers understand and expect to pay premium
Mixed Materials (SS top + galvanized frame)LowestBudget-conscious buyers, non-food-contact furniture, temporary setupsMaterial authenticity concerns, potential rust issues, not NSF certifiableGrowing buyer skepticism, negative reviews common, not recommended for food service
Cost levels are relative comparisons within the commercial furniture category. Actual pricing varies by supplier, order quantity, and market conditions [1][2][3][4].

Welding and Fabrication Standards: Critical Quality Factors

Material grade and surface finish are only part of the equation. Welding and fabrication quality significantly impacts product performance and buyer satisfaction. Poor welding creates contamination traps, reduces corrosion resistance, and generates negative reviews—even when base materials are high-grade [5].

AWS D18.1 is the American Welding Society specification for welding austenitic stainless steel tubing and piping for food processing and dairy applications. While originally designed for piping, its principles apply to commercial furniture fabrication:

  • Back Purging: Using inert gas (argon) on the backside of welds prevents oxidation that creates rough, contamination-prone surfaces
  • Weld Grinding: All welds must be ground smooth to match surrounding surface finish (Ra requirements apply to welds too)
  • Passivation: Post-weld chemical treatment restores chromium oxide layer that provides corrosion resistance
  • Visual Inspection: Welds should show no discoloration, porosity, or undercutting [5]

For Southeast Asian exporters, investing in proper welding equipment and training pays dividends in reduced returns and positive reviews. Many negative Amazon reviews mention rust spots appearing 'overnight' after assembly—this often traces to poor weld quality or inadequate passivation, not base material defects. Documenting welding procedures and providing certification can differentiate your products in competitive markets [4][5].

Cleaning and Sanitation Protocols: What Buyers Need to Know

Even the highest-grade stainless steel will underperform if cleaning protocols are inappropriate. Sellers who provide clear cleaning guidance reduce buyer complaints and demonstrate product expertise.

Acceptable Cleaning Agents: Mild detergents, diluted bleach solutions (for sanitization), commercial stainless steel cleaners. Avoid chloride-based cleaners on 304 grade in high-concentration applications.

Prohibited Cleaning Tools: Steel wool, abrasive pads, or wire brushes that scratch surfaces and create bacterial harborage points. Use soft cloths or non-abrasive sponges.

Maintenance Frequency: Daily cleaning for food contact surfaces; weekly deep cleaning with passivation-restoring cleaners for high-use equipment; immediate cleanup of salt, acid, or chemical spills.

Warning Signs: Rust spots, pitting, or discoloration indicate either material defects, inappropriate cleaning agents, or environmental conditions exceeding material capabilities. Document these issues for warranty claims [3].

Including a printed cleaning guide with products—especially for international buyers who may not have access to local technical support—reduces misuse-related complaints and positions your brand as professional and customer-focused.
